Output 39c3018c7af856103e79a91c77c0699aecbf386e83b77c8a9ca2b6b979e42d9a:3

value
3062666574
script pubkey
OP_0 OP_PUSHBYTES_20 6fd78b4bc4577637258df76b0df8f74f09e9473f
address
bc1qdltckj7y2amrwfvd7a4sm78hfuy7j3elpkwwn5
transaction
39c3018c7af856103e79a91c77c0699aecbf386e83b77c8a9ca2b6b979e42d9a
confirmations
165098
spent
true